The main functions of vanadium in steel are:
(1) Refine the microstructure and grain of steel, improve the grain coarsening temperature, thus reducing the sensitivity of overheating, and improve the strength and toughness of steel.
(2) when dissolved into austenite at high temperature, increase the hardenability of steel; In contrast, in the presence of carbide, the hardenability of the steel is reduced.
(3) Increase the hardenability and tempering stability of quenched steel, refine the grain, and produce secondary hardening effect.
(4) The solid solubility of vanadium carbide and vanadium nitride in austenite is higher. Therefore, it is not easy to produce cracks caused by precipitation at high temperature, and the tendency of cracks in the billet is small in the solidification process.
(5) Vanadium and nitrogen have strong binding force and can form vanadium nitride, which is conducive to reducing strain aging of steel, which is very important for steel bars undergoing cold deformation in the service process.
